Quick Answer: Is Hydrolyzed Keratin Good for Hair Growth?
Hydrolyzed keratin for hair growth does not directly stimulate hair follicles or increase hair density. However, it plays an essential role in strengthening the hair shaft, reducing breakage, and improving hair integrity. Healthier, stronger hair fibers can grow longer with less breakage, which is why hydrolyzed keratin is often associated with improved hair growth outcomes in practical use. This distinction is crucial: hydrolyzed keratin supports hair retention rather than follicle activation, making it a valuable ingredient in hair care formulations.
Understanding the Difference Between Hair Growth and Hair Retention
While hair growth refers to the process of follicle activity—where hair emerges and elongates—hair retention focuses on the ability to maintain existing hair without excessive breakage. Hair can grow at a normal rate, but if it is weak or brittle, it is more likely to break before it reaches its full length. This is where hydrolyzed keratin comes in.
Hydrolyzed keratin strengthens and smooths the hair shaft, making it less prone to mechanical damage from brushing, washing, and styling. This leads to longer-lasting hair fibers and, by extension, the appearance of healthier, fuller hair.
What Is Hydrolyzed Keratin and How Is It Produced?
Hydrolyzed keratin is a water-soluble form of the natural protein keratin, produced by breaking down keratin from animal sources (such as wool, feathers, and animal hair) through controlled enzymatic or chemical hydrolysis. This process reduces the molecular size of keratin into peptides, making it more suitable for cosmetic formulations. These keratin peptides are then able to effectively bind to damaged areas of the hair fiber, reinforcing strength and improving hair integrity.
To make keratin functional for hair care products, it must first be converted into a usable form. Hydrolyzed keratin is produced by extracting keratin from natural protein-rich sources—most commonly wool, feathers, or animal hair—and then processing it through controlled enzymatic or chemical hydrolysis. During this process, the long keratin protein chains are broken down into shorter peptide fragments, reducing molecular weight while preserving keratin’s amino acid profile.
The result is a water-soluble keratin peptide ingredient with improved compatibility in shampoos, conditioners, masks, and treatments. These hydrolyzed keratin peptides are small enough to disperse evenly in aqueous systems and interact effectively with damaged regions of the hair fiber. Rather than remaining on the surface as an inert coating, they can temporarily bind to weakened areas of the cuticle, supporting hair strength and flexibility.
From a formulation perspective, this transformation—from insoluble native keratin to hydrolyzed keratin for hair care applications—is what allows keratin-based ingredients to deliver consistent performance. Molecular weight control during hydrolysis is particularly important, as it influences solubility, deposition behavior, and sensory feel in finished products.
In practical terms, hydrolyzed keratin is not a single molecule, but a carefully engineered mixture of keratin-derived peptides designed to balance stability, functionality, and formulation compatibility.
How Hydrolyzed Keratin Supports Hair Growth Indirectly
While hydrolyzed keratin doesn’t directly stimulate hair follicle activity, it plays a significant role in improving the quality of hair fibers. By reducing breakage and enhancing the overall health of the hair strand, hydrolyzed keratin helps to preserve hair that is already growing. Here’s how:
Strengthening the Hair Shaft
Hydrolyzed keratin provides a protective coating that fills micro-cracks and imperfections along the hair cuticle. This strengthens the hair, preventing it from becoming weak and brittle.
Reducing Breakage and Split Ends
Weak, brittle hair is more prone to breakage, especially at the ends. Hydrolyzed keratin reduces hair fiber fragility by improving its elasticity, allowing hair to stretch without snapping.
Improving Moisture Retention
Keratin peptides also help maintain optimal moisture levels within the hair fiber, which is crucial for maintaining hair strength. Well-hydrated hair is less likely to become dry and brittle, further reducing the chances of breakage.
Hair Growth Rate: What the Research Shows
When discussing hair growth, it is important to start with what is already well established in both clinical and cosmetic research. Multiple studies across different populations show that human scalp hair grows at an average rate of approximately 1.0–1.3 cm per month, or about 0.3–0.4 mm per day. While minor variations exist due to genetics, age, sex, and health status, the overall growth rate remains relatively consistent across ethnic groups.
Research conducted in both Western and Asian populations indicates that the hair growth cycle itself is slow and biologically regulated, meaning that dramatic increases in growth speed are uncommon without medical intervention. This is why most cosmetic ingredients—including hydrolyzed keratin for hair growth—are not expected to accelerate follicle activity in a measurable way.
However, several studies also highlight a key secondary factor: hair breakage significantly affects perceived growth. Even when follicles are producing hair at a normal rate, weak or damaged hair fibers can fracture before length becomes visible. This phenomenon explains why individuals with chemically treated, heat-damaged, or environmentally stressed hair often report “slow growth,” despite normal follicle function.
From this perspective, ingredients such as hydrolyzed keratin for hair contribute to hair growth outcomes indirectly. By reinforcing the hair shaft, improving tensile strength, and reducing mechanical breakage, keratin peptides help preserve the length that hair naturally gains during each growth cycle. Over time, this leads to improved length retention and the appearance of healthier, fuller hair.
This distinction is well recognized in cosmetic science literature, where hair growth is increasingly evaluated not only by follicle activity, but also by fiber durability and resistance to breakage. In this context, hydrolyzed keratin shampoo and treatment products play a supportive but meaningful role in long-term hair care routines.
Does Hydrolyzed Keratin Stimulate Hair Follicles?
It is important to be precise here. Hydrolyzed keratin does not act as a follicle stimulant. It does not alter the hair growth cycle, activate dormant follicles, or increase hair density at the scalp.
Ingredients that directly affect follicle behavior typically involve bioactive compounds, signaling molecules, or nutrients that interact with scalp physiology. Hydrolyzed keratin functions differently—it improves the output of the follicle (the hair fiber) rather than the follicle itself.
This clarity is essential for setting realistic expectations in both product development and consumer education.
Why Hydrolyzed Keratin Is Common in Hair Growth–Focused Products
Many products marketed for hair growth include hydrolyzed keratin shampoo or treatments even though the ingredient does not stimulate follicles. This is not misleading when properly understood.
Hair growth routines often aim to:
•Reduce hair loss caused by breakage;
•Improve hair strength during the growth phase;
•Support overall hair appearance and manageability.
In this context, hydrolyzed keratin plays a complementary role. When hair fibers are stronger and less prone to damage, the visible result is longer, fuller-looking hair over time.
Evidence from Hair Fiber Science
Studies in cosmetic science consistently show that protein-derived peptides can improve hair fiber strength, surface smoothness, and resistance to mechanical stress. While these studies do not claim follicle stimulation, they demonstrate measurable improvements in hair durability.
This body of evidence supports the practical use of hydrolyzed keratin for hair growth–related formulations, particularly when the goal is to improve hair quality rather than alter biological growth processes.
Choosing the Right Hydrolyzed Keratin for Hair Care Formulations
Not all hydrolyzed keratin ingredients perform equally. For formulators and buyers, quality is determined by several key parameters:
♦Molecular weight distribution;
♦Water solubility;
♦Odor and color profile;
♦Batch-to-batch consistency;
♦Availability of COA and MSDS.

Frequently Asked Questions
Does hydrolyzed keratin help hair grow faster?
No. It does not accelerate follicle growth but helps hair retain length by reducing breakage.
Is hydrolyzed keratin suitable for daily use?
Yes. Cosmetic-grade hydrolyzed keratin is widely used in daily hair care products.
Can hydrolyzed keratin improve thinning hair appearance?
It can improve the appearance of thinning hair by strengthening fibers and reducing breakage, making hair look fuller.
